How to Calculate Dates Between Two Dates

There are several ways to find dates between two dates, depending on whether you prefer manual methods, spreadsheet tools, or programming.

Manual Calculation: Understanding the Basics

At its core, calculating the number of days between two dates involves counting each day starting from the day after the start date up to the day before the end date. Here are a few simple steps:

  1. Convert each date to a uniform format, such as YYYY-MM-DD.
  2. Calculate the difference in days by subtracting the earlier date from the later date.
  3. List the dates sequentially, adding one day at a time.

While this is straightforward for small ranges, it becomes impractical for longer periods, especially when considering weekends, holidays, or leap years.

Using Excel or Google Sheets

Spreadsheets provide powerful tools to handle dates between two dates without manual counting. Here’s a simple way to generate a list of dates in Excel:

  • Enter the start date in cell A1 and the end date in cell B1.
  • In cell A2, enter the formula: =A1+1
  • Drag this formula down to increment the date by one each row until you reach the end date.

You can also use the NETWORKDAYS function if you want to calculate only working days between two dates, excluding weekends and holidays.

Programming Solutions

If you’re comfortable with coding, programming languages like Python, JavaScript, and SQL offer efficient ways to handle dates between two dates.

For example, in Python, you can use the datetime module:

from datetime import datetime, timedelta

start_date = datetime.strptime('2024-01-01', '%Y-%m-%d')
end_date = datetime.strptime('2024-01-10', '%Y-%m-%d')

current_date = start_date + timedelta(days=1)
dates_between = []

while current_date < end_date:
    dates_between.append(current_date.strftime('%Y-%m-%d'))
    current_date += timedelta(days=1)

print(dates_between)

This script generates a list of dates between January 1 and January 10, excluding the start and end dates by default.

Advanced Considerations When Working With Dates Between Two Dates

Sometimes, simply listing dates isn’t enough. There are additional factors to consider that can affect how you calculate or use dates between two dates.

Accounting for Time Zones

If your application spans multiple time zones, the start and end dates might represent different days depending on location. Ensuring consistency may require converting all dates to a common time zone or using UTC when storing and calculating dates.

Handling Leap Years and Variable Month Lengths

Not all months have the same number of days, and leap years add an extra day to February. When calculating dates between two dates, it's important to use tools or libraries that account for these variations to avoid off-by-one errors.

Excluding Weekends and Holidays

In business contexts, you might want to calculate only the working days between two dates. This requires excluding weekends and possibly company-specific holidays. Many spreadsheet functions and programming libraries support this through customizable parameters.

Methods for Calculating Dates Between Two Dates

The approach to calculating dates between two dates varies depending on the context, programming environment, or the analytical tools in use. The complexity can range from simple subtraction of dates to more sophisticated operations that account for business days, holidays, or leap years.

Basic Date Difference Calculation

In its simplest form, the difference between two dates is calculated by subtracting the earlier date from the later date, yielding the number of days between them. For instance, in many spreadsheet applications like Microsoft Excel, the formula:

=DATEDIF(Start_Date, End_Date, "d")

returns the total days between the two dates. Similarly, programming languages offer built-in functions; Python’s datetime module allows:

delta = end_date - start_date
days_between = delta.days

This method efficiently handles the calculation of elapsed days, including leap years, without any extra effort.

Generating a List of Dates Within the Range

Sometimes, the need transcends mere counting, requiring the enumeration of every date between two dates. This is particularly useful in scheduling applications or data filtering processes.

For example, using Python:

from datetime import timedelta, date

def daterange(start_date, end_date):
    for n in range(int((end_date - start_date).days) + 1):
        yield start_date + timedelta(n)

for single_date in daterange(start_date, end_date):
    print(single_date.strftime("%Y-%m-%d"))

This snippet not only calculates the number of days but outputs each date, enabling more granular control over date-based operations.

Considering Business Days and Holidays

In corporate environments, the count of business days—excluding weekends and holidays—is often more relevant than calendar days. Tools like Python’s pandas library provide functions such as bdate_range() that facilitate this nuanced calculation. Similarly, Excel’s NETWORKDAYS function returns the number of working days between two dates, excluding weekends and optionally specified holidays.

This level of sophistication is critical for accurate project timelines, payroll calculations, and compliance with labor regulations.

Data Analytics and Reporting

Data analysts often filter datasets to include only records within a specific date range to discern trends or generate periodical reports. SQL queries commonly use WHERE clauses such as:

WHERE date_column BETWEEN '2023-01-01' AND '2023-01-31'

to extract data strictly within the desired interval.

Tools and Technologies Supporting Date Range Calculations

Multiple software solutions and programming libraries facilitate handling dates between two dates, each with distinct features and levels of complexity.

Spreadsheet Software

Microsoft Excel and Google Sheets offer built-in date functions that cater to straightforward date difference calculations and conditional formatting based on date ranges. Functions like DATEDIF, NETWORKDAYS, and DATEVALUE enable users to conduct manual or automated analyses.

Programming Languages

Languages such as Python, JavaScript, and Java provide robust date-time libraries:

  • Python: datetime, pandas, dateutil
  • JavaScript: Date object, moment.js (deprecated but still in use), date-fns
  • Java: java.time package introduced in Java 8

These libraries support date arithmetic, formatting, and parsing, simplifying the manipulation of date ranges.

Database Systems

Relational database management systems (RDBMS) like MySQL, PostgreSQL, and Oracle support date functions within SQL queries, enabling filtering and aggregation over date ranges. Indexing strategies on date columns can optimize performance for queries involving dates between two dates.

Challenges and Considerations When Working with Dates Between Two Dates

Despite the availability of numerous tools, calculating and utilizing dates between two dates presents challenges that require careful consideration.

Time Zone Differences

When dealing with global data, time zones can affect the exact interpretation of dates. A date that is valid in one time zone might differ in another, potentially skewing calculations if not standardized.

Leap Years and Daylight Savings

Accounting for leap years is crucial for accurate day counts over extended periods. Similarly, daylight saving time changes can affect time calculations but usually have less impact on date-only operations.

Date Format Inconsistencies

Different systems and locales use varying date formats (e.g., MM/DD/YYYY vs. DD/MM/YYYY), which can cause errors during parsing or comparisons if not normalized.

Inclusive vs. Exclusive Counting

One subtlety lies in deciding whether the start and end dates themselves count towards the total. This decision should align with the specific business logic or analytical requirements.

💡 Frequently Asked Questions

How can I find all dates between two given dates in Python?

You can use a loop with the datetime module to iterate from the start date to the end date, incrementing by one day each time, and collect all dates in a list.

What is the best SQL query to retrieve records between two dates?

Use the BETWEEN operator in your SQL query, for example: SELECT * FROM table WHERE date_column BETWEEN '2024-01-01' AND '2024-01-31';

How do I calculate the number of days between two dates in Excel?

Simply subtract the earlier date from the later date, like =B1 - A1, assuming A1 and B1 contain the two dates.

How can I generate a list of dates between two dates in JavaScript?

Use a loop starting from the start date, incrementing by one day using setDate(), and push each date to an array until you reach the end date.

What libraries can help handle date ranges in Python?

Libraries like pandas and dateutil provide convenient functions to handle date ranges and date arithmetic in Python.

How to handle time zones when calculating dates between two dates?

Use timezone-aware datetime objects to ensure calculations respect time zone differences, such as using pytz or zoneinfo in Python.

Can I find weekdays only between two dates?

Yes, by iterating through the date range and filtering out weekends (Saturday and Sunday) using the weekday() method.

How to find the number of months between two dates?

Calculate the difference in years and months separately or use specialized libraries like dateutil.relativedelta for accurate month differences.

Is there a way to find business days between two dates?

Yes, you can use libraries like pandas in Python with the BDay offset or create a custom function that excludes weekends and holidays.

How do I validate that one date is between two other dates?

Check if the date is greater than or equal to the start date and less than or equal to the end date using comparison operators.
